Why Choose a Hand-Cut Roof?
Hand-cut roofs, often called 'traditional cut and pitch' roofs, are constructed by skilled carpenters who calculate and cut every individual timber rafter, purlin, and beam to fit the exact dimensions and specifications of the building.
- Flexibility for Complex Designs: Ideal for properties in Harlow with unique requirements, such as dormer windows, varying roof slopes, non-standard angles, or large, open attic spaces.
- Superior Strength: The structural members are precisely tied and fixed together, often resulting in a more robust and rigid structure than standard truss systems.
- Maximised Loft Space: Hand-cut roofs often create an open, useable loft area (ready for future conversion) without the restrictive webbing of factory-made trusses.
- Adaptability for Renovations: Essential for seamless integration when extending an existing property where standard trusses will not align.
